COVID-19 Risk Stratification
NCT04339387 · Status: COMPLETED ·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 1326
Last updated 2020-11-30
Summary
The investigators seek to derive and validate a clinically useful risk score for patients with Coronavirus Disease 2019 to aide clinicians in the safe discharge of patients.
